Cedar shingle repair services involve addressing issues related to the deterioration or damage of cedar roofing materials. Over time, cedar shingles can develop problems such as cracking, splitting, warping, or curling due to exposure to weather elements. Repair services typically include replacing damaged shingles, resealing or re-staining affected areas, and reinforcing the shingles to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per repair helps maintain the roof’s appearance and prevents further deterioration that could lead to leaks or structural issues.
These services help resolve common problems associated with aging or weathered cedar shingles. Damage from wind, hail, or prolonged moisture exposure can cause shingles to loosen or break apart, increasing the risk of water infiltration. Repairing these issues not only improves the roof’s durability but also helps prevent costly repairs to underlying structures. Additionally, addressing cosmetic damage such as discoloration or surface wear can enhance the overall aesthetic of a property, especially for homes or buildings where appearance is important.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Beachwood,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for cedar shingle repairs 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and shingles needed.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ive work can approach the higher end.
Material Expenses - Replacing cedar shingles generally costs between $4 and $8 per square foot, with total expenses influenced by the number of shingles and labor rates in the local area. Larger repairs will naturally increase overall costs.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for cedar shingle repair services often fall between $50 and $100 per hour, varying with project complexity and local market rates. The total labor cost depends on the scope of repair work required.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of damaged shingles or surface preparation can add $100 to $500 to the total cost. These costs depend on the specific repair needs and site conditions in Beachwood, OH.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my cedar shingles need repair? Signs include visible rot, cracking, curling, or missing shingles. If shingles appear weathered or damaged, it may be time to consult a local contractor for an assessment.
What types of repairs are common for cedar shingles? Common repairs involve replacing damaged or missing shingles, sealing leaks, and addressing rot or mold issues to maintain roof integrity.
How long do cedar shingles typically last before needing repairs? Cedar shingles generally last 20-30 years, but repairs may be needed sooner if they sustain weather damage or neglect.
Are there preventive measures to reduce cedar shingle damage? Regular inspections, cleaning, and applying protective treatments can help extend the lifespan of cedar shingles and prevent costly repairs.
